Battery
The battery provides at least 7 hours of battery life when new and fully
charged with no alarms, no serial data, no analog output, no nurse call
output, with backlight on while using an SRC-MAX set at 200 bpm, high
light and low modulation.

Wavelength
Nellcor pulse oximetry sensors contain LEDs that emit
and Power
red light at a wavelength of approximately 660 nm and
infrared light at a wavelength of approximately 900 nm.
The total optical output power of the sensor LEDs is less
than 15 mW. This information may be useful to
clinicians, such as those performing photodynamic
therapy.
